About Sanford, TX
Sanford is a small community in Texas with a population of 113 residents. The median household income is $29,750 per year, which is below the national average. The median age in Sanford is 32.3 years.
Housing in Sanford has a median home value of $42,900 and median monthly rent of $0. Of the 69 total housing units, the majority are owner-occupied, with 26 owner-occupied and 1 renter-occupied units.
The unemployment rate in Sanford is 0.0% and the poverty rate is 56.6%. 0.0%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The average commute time is 20.3 minutes.
